We have countless examples of salvaging building materials , as well as estate furniture, lab fixtures, commercial offices, and everything else imaginable. Here is one example. Last year for a house renovation , we managed the recovery of about 5,000 square feet of flooring, along with interior trim ,doors and windows. Some material, such as the 3″ oak pictured below, was sold directly from the jobsite. Other material was donated to materials reuse stores, and some was reused onsite by the owners.
